The Ancients Knew The Talking Stones
Living stones like this are put on earth by spirit to bond with you and become your companion. Those who traditionally were closer to the earth and nature knew this.
-
Native Americans like the Hopi believed that stones, especially turquoise, held the breath of life and spiritual presence. They were used in sacred altars and rituals, treated as more than objects—each stone was honored as a being.
-
The Zuni believed some stones were truly alive, with spirits inside them. Fetishes carved from turquoise and other sacred materials were spoken to, fed, and carried for their spiritual guidance and protection. These weren’t symbols—they were spiritual companions.
-
The Navajo viewed sacred stones like turquoise as gifts from the Holy People. They held living power, carried the energy of sky and water, and were treated as sacred allies in healing and protection.
-
The Apache believed powerful stones—especially turquoise—could enhance hunting and protect warriors, and some oral traditions say these stones formed where the rainbow touched the earth. They were seen as spirit-charged gifts from the land.
